WebNov 17, 2024 · One of the things that must be considered with VLANs is the function of the Spanning Tree Protocol (STP). STP is designed to prevent loops in a switch/bridged topology to eliminate the endless propagation of broadcast around the loop. With VLANs, there are multiple broadcast domains to be considered. WebNov 29, 2024 · To make sure a loop-free topology, the Rapid Spanning Tree Protocol (RSTP) precludes some of the connections which permit only a single active path between any two devices. All these disabled connections can be used as backup paths in case an active connection fails. The IEEE standard for Rapid spanning tree protocol is 802.1w.
